Main Ingredients

  • Chicken thighs or chicken breast (boneless, skinless)
    Chicken thighs are highly recommended for this recipe because they remain juicy and tender during cooking. However, chicken breast works well if you prefer a leaner option—just be careful not to overcook it.
  • Long-grain white rice
    This type of rice cooks evenly and stays fluffy, making it ideal for one-pan dishes. Avoid short-grain rice, as it can become too sticky.
  • Honey
    Adds natural sweetness and helps create that irresistible caramelized glaze on the chicken. Opt for pure, high-quality honey for the best flavor.
  • BBQ sauce
    Choose a rich, smoky BBQ sauce that complements the honey. You can use store-bought or homemade depending on your preference.
  • Chicken broth or stock
    This is essential for cooking the rice and infusing it with deep, savory flavor. Using broth instead of water makes a noticeable difference.

Step-by-Step Preparation Guide

Cooking this dish is straightforward, but following each step carefully will ensure the best results.

Step 1: Prepare the Chicken

Start by patting the chicken dry with a paper towel. This helps achieve a better sear. Season both sides generously with salt, black pepper, and paprika. If you want a deeper flavor, you can let the chicken sit with the seasoning for 10–15 minutes before cooking.

Step 2: Sear the Chicken

Heat a large skillet or pan over medium-high heat and add a drizzle of olive oil. Once the oil is hot, place the chicken in the pan. Let it cook undisturbed for about 4–5 minutes on each side until it develops a golden-brown crust.

This step is crucial—it locks in juices and builds a flavorful base for the entire dish. Once seared, remove the chicken from the pan and set it aside.

Step 3: Sauté the Aromatics

In the same pan, reduce the heat to medium and add a little more oil if needed. Toss in the chopped onions and cook until they become soft and translucent. Then add the minced garlic and sauté for another 30–60 seconds until fragrant.

Be careful not to burn the garlic, as it can turn bitter quickly.

Step 4: Add the Rice

Pour the uncooked rice directly into the pan with the aromatics. Stir it gently for about 1–2 minutes to lightly toast the grains. This step enhances the flavor and helps the rice maintain its texture during cooking.

Step 5: Build the Flavor Base

Now, add the chicken broth, honey, and BBQ sauce to the pan. Stir everything together until well combined. Taste the mixture and adjust seasoning if necessary—this is your chance to balance the sweetness, saltiness, and smokiness.

Step 6: Return the Chicken

Place the seared chicken back into the pan, nestling it into the rice mixture. Spoon a little of the sauce over the chicken to coat it.

Step 7: Simmer to Perfection

Cover the pan with a lid and reduce the heat to low. Let everything simmer gently for about 18–25 minutes, or until the rice is fully cooked and has absorbed most of the liquid.

Avoid lifting the lid too often, as this can disrupt the cooking process.

Step 8: Final Touches

Once the rice is tender and the chicken is cooked through, remove the pan from heat. Let it rest for a few minutes before serving. Garnish with fresh parsley and sesame seeds for a vibrant finish.

Recipe Variations You Can Try

One of the strengths of this dish is how easily it can be customized to suit different tastes and dietary needs.

Spicy Honey BBQ Chicken Rice

Add chili flakes, cayenne pepper, or even a dash of hot sauce to the sauce mixture for a bold, spicy twist. This variation is perfect if you enjoy heat with your sweetness.

Vegetable-Packed Version

Boost the nutritional value by adding vegetables like bell peppers, peas, carrots, or corn. Simply stir them in when you add the rice so they cook evenly.

Brown Rice Alternative

For a healthier option, substitute white rice with brown rice. Keep in mind that brown rice requires a longer cooking time and slightly more liquid.

Cheesy Twist

If you want to make the dish extra indulgent, sprinkle shredded cheese over the top during the last few minutes of cooking and let it melt into the rice.

Expert Tips for Perfect Results

Cooking a one-pan dish may seem simple, but a few professional tips can take your meal from good to exceptional.

  • Don’t skip the searing step
    This is where a lot of the flavor develops. A properly seared chicken adds richness to the entire dish.
  • Use the right pan
    A heavy-bottomed skillet or pan with a tight-fitting lid ensures even cooking and prevents the rice from burning.
  • Measure your liquid carefully
    Too much liquid can make the rice mushy, while too little can leave it undercooked.
  • Let it rest before serving
    Allowing the dish to sit for a few minutes helps the flavors settle and improves texture.
  • Taste as you go
    Adjust seasoning at different stages to achieve a well-balanced final dish.

How to Store and Reheat

Proper storage ensures you can enjoy this dish even after the first serving without losing its flavor or texture.

Refrigeration

Allow the dish to c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container. Store in the refrigerator for up to 3–4 days.

Freezing

For longer storage, place the cooled chicken and rice in freezer-safe containers or bags. It can be stored for up to 2–3 months. For best results, divide into individual portions before freezing.

Reheating

To reheat, add a splash of chicken broth or water to prevent the rice from drying out. Warm it in a pan over medium heat or in the microwave, stirring occasionally to ensure even heating.

One-Pan Honey BBQ Chicken Rice

A flavorful, one-pan dinner featuring juicy honey BBQ glazed chicken cooked alongside perfectly seasoned, fluffy rice. This easy chicken and rice recipe delivers a sweet, smoky, and savory combination that’s perfect for busy weeknights or comforting family meals.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Total Time 45 minutes
Servings: 4
Course: Dinner, Main Course
Cuisine: American
Calories: 500

Ingredients
  

Main Ingredients:
  • 500 g 1 lb boneless, skinless chicken thighs or chicken breast
  • 1 cup long-grain white rice uncooked
  • 2 tablespoons honey
  • ½ cup BBQ sauce smoky or sweet
  • 2 cups chicken broth or stock
Aromatics & Seasonings:
  • 1 small onion finely chopped
  • 3 cloves garlic minced
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• Salt and black pepper to taste
  • Optional: ½ teaspoon chili flakes or cayenne pepper for heat
Garnish (Optional):
  • Fresh parsley chopped
  • Sesame seeds

Equipment

  • Large skillet or deep pan with lid
  • Wooden spoon or spatula
  • Measuring cups and spoons
  • Mixing bowl (optional)

Method
 

Season the Chicken:
  1. Pat the chicken dry and season both sides with salt, pepper, and paprika.
Sear the Chicken:
  1. Heat olive oil in a large pan over medium-high heat. Sear the chicken for 4–5 minutes per side until golden brown. Remove and set aside.
Sauté Aromatics:
  1. In the same pan, add chopped onions and cook until soft. Stir in garlic and cook for about 30 seconds until fragrant.
Toast the Rice:
  1. Add the uncooked rice to the pan and stir for 1–2 minutes to lightly toast.
Add Liquids and Flavor:
  1. Pour in chicken broth, honey, and BBQ sauce. Stir well to combine.
Return Chicken to Pan:
  1. Place the seared chicken back into the pan, nestling it into the rice mixture. Spoon sauce over the chicken.
Simmer:
  1. Cover with a lid, reduce heat to low, and cook for 18–25 minutes until the rice is tender and the chicken is fully cooked.
Rest and Garnish:
  1. Remove from heat, let it rest for a few minutes, then garnish with parsley and sesame seeds before serving.

Notes

Chicken thighs provide more flavor and remain juicier than chicken breast.
Adjust the sweetness by reducing or increasing the honey to taste.
For best results, avoid lifting the lid frequently while the rice is cooking.
Add vegetables like bell peppers, peas, or carrots for extra nutrition and color.
If using brown rice, increase cooking time and liquid accordingly.
